Job Description
Andretti Indoor Karting & Games is a premier Family Entertainment Center that offers an exciting blend of activities including indoor multi-level karting tracks, immersive multi-player virtual reality simulators, vibrant arcade games, exceptional event spaces, and unique dining experiences. With locations across several states including Florida, Georgia, Texas, and Arizona, Andretti continues to grow rapidly and expand its footprint in the United States. Known for its commitment to cleanliness, safety, and excellent customer service, the company prides itself on creating an exhilarating environment where guests of all ages can enjoy fun-filled experiences. Job Duties
- Welcome visitors by greeting them in a friendly and positive manner
- Set up and break down event spaces per event contract, management and floor diagram
- Host entire event, supervise all activities and ensure guests are pleased with their visit
- Maintain proper food and beverage temperature, and correct utensils are used
- Pay attention to details, focus on guests, and understand event contracts
- Deliver energetic guest service with a sense of urgency
- Observe, instruct and monitor guests for safety and guideline adherence
- Assist with any guest recovery and ensure positive guest experiences
- Maintain constant working knowledge of Andretti brand, product and policies and procedures
- Communicate clearly and professionally while interacting enthusiastically with guests and fellow co-workers
- Be aware and knowledgeable of facility emergency procedures
- Perform opening, running and closing department duties as assigned
